Polarization, one of the fundamental properties of electromagnetic waves, provides extra physical dimensions for multiplexing optical information, enabling applications such as multidimensional spectroscopy ( 1), high-capacity communication ( 2– 4), ultrafast detection/modulation ( 5, 6), polarization-controlled holography ( 7), and others ( 8, 9). While our HAD nanowires use phase-change materials as the active material, this concept is readily generalized to other active materials hybridized with dielectrics and thus has the potential in a broad range of applications from photonic memories and routing to polarization-multiplexed computing. By using polarization as the tunable vector, we show matrix-vector multiplication in a nanowire device configuration. We then demonstrate the ability to use polarization as a parameter to selectively modulate the conductance of individual nanowires within a multi-nanowire system. Here, we introduce hybridized-active-dielectric (HAD) nanowires to achieve polarization-selective tunability. While wavelength-selective systems have widely proliferated, polarization-addressable active photonics has not seen notable progress, primarily because tunable and polarization-selective nanostructures have been elusive. Vector images are ideally suited for logos which may be blown up into print, for instance on clothing, car wraps, billboards, magazines, bus station ads - anything which requires the image to be scaled up a large amount. They can easily be edited and manipulated to change colors, shapes, and text, making them a go-to tool for graphic design. No matter the size of the image, it will not become blurry or pixelated like a bitmap image. The main benefit of a vector image is that it is instantly scalable with pristine resolution. Examples of raster image files are JPEGs, PNGs, and GIFs.
